Failure to Provide Quarterly Resident Trust Fund Statements

Summary
The facility failed to provide quarterly statements to residents with personal trust fund accounts, as required by both facility policy and the signed Resident Fund Management Service Authorization Agreement. Record review showed that a resident who had authorized the facility to manage their funds did not receive any quarterly statements for their account, despite the agreement specifying that statements would be provided at least quarterly. The resident's account had a balance, but the resident reported not receiving statements and being unaware of the account balance, even after making multiple requests for this information. An interview with the Business Office Manager confirmed that no quarterly statements had been distributed to residents or their guardians. The facility's policy requires accurate and timely information to be provided to residents regarding their personal funds, but this was not followed. The deficiency was identified through record review, resident and staff interviews, and policy review, affecting at least one resident directly, with the potential to impact others with similar accounts.
